Istanbul shopping area hit by suicide bomber

AKIPRESS.COM - Turkish police, forensics and emergency services, work at the blast scene.A suicide bomb attack at a busy shopping area in the Turkish city of Istanbul has killed at least four people, officials say.

Up to 20 people were injured, three seriously, reports BBC.

The area - Istiklal Street - is reportedly crowded at weekends.

Last Sunday, an attack in the capital, Ankara, killed 37 people. Kurdish rebel group TAK claimed that attack, saying it was in revenge for Turkish military operations against Kurds.

Last month, a bomb attack on a military convoy in Ankara killed 28 people and wounded dozens more.
